开源项目《Open Library》下载与安装教程
1. 项目介绍
Open Library 是一个始于2006年的雄心勃勃的计划,旨在为有史以来出版的每本书创建一个网页。“一个网页,每一本书”——这是其核心理念。此项目不仅是一个可编辑的图书目录,而且向公众提供大量公有领域书籍和绝版书的在线阅读机会。通过这个平台,读者、开发者和图书爱好者可以共同构建一个丰富的图书资源库。
注意:此处应插入Open Library的logo图,但因实际环境中不可得,以文字描述代替
2. 项目下载位置
该项目托管在GitHub上,您可以从以下链接访问并下载它:
[Open Library GitHub Repository](https://github.com/internetarchive/openlibrary.git)
要克隆项目到本地,使用Git命令行执行:
git clone https://github.com/internetarchive/openlibrary.git
3. 项目安装环境配置
系统需求
- 操作系统: Linux, macOS 或 Windows(推荐Linux或macOS以获得最佳体验)
- Docker: 由于推荐使用Docker来简化安装过程,确保你的系统已安装最新版本的Docker。
- Git: 安装用于代码获取。
图片示例:安装Docker
由于文本格式无法直接嵌入图片,以下为简要步骤:
- 访问Docker官方网站。
- 下载对应操作系统的安装包。
- 按照指引完成安装。
- 在终端或命令提示符输入
docker --version
验证安装成功。
4. 项目安装方式
使用Docker安装
- 导航至项目根目录。
- 运行以下命令启动开发环境:
docker-compose up
这将自动下载所有必要的依赖,并在本地运行Open Library服务。完成后,访问http://localhost:8080
即可开始使用。
手动安装步骤(备选)
手动安装涉及更多细节,包括Python环境设置、依赖安装等,但官方强烈建议使用Docker。若需手动安装详细步骤,参考项目中的文档。
5. 项目处理脚本
在Docker环境下,主要的管理任务通常通过Docker Compose命令进行。例如,运行测试可以通过以下命令完成:
docker-compose run --rm home make test
如果你需要更详细的脚本来自动化部署或管理,可以在.docker-compose.yml
文件或项目文档中找到相关指令和配置示例。
通过上述步骤,您应该能够顺利下载并搭建起Open Library的本地开发环境。加入这个致力于数字化图书世界的社区,一起贡献您的力量吧!
请注意,文中提到的图片示例和具体路径仅为示意,实际情况请参照实际项目文档。